I pulled my egr tube to replace it and replace gaskets on it. There is oil in the tube, is this normal ? And the gasket on the end connecting to the plenum has a smaller hole in it than on the other end, is this the way it should be ? Thanks for any replies.

quote
Originally posted by NiotaFiero:

There is oil in the tube, is this normal ?


It's probably working it's way there from the breather tube which is stuck in the rubber elbow just before the TB. Some oil is probably "normal", although the less the better.

 
quote
Originally posted by NiotaFiero:

And the gasket on the end connecting to the plenum has a smaller hole in it than on the other end, is this the way it should be ?


I believe that's correct.

quote
Originally posted by NiotaFiero:

And the gasket on the end connecting to the plenum has a smaller hole in it than on the other end, is this the way it should be ?



Yes. This stops a high idle run away condition if the EGR tube breaks off the flange.
